Skip to main content
itin.net
Visual cover for EIN guidance for OPT workers based in Bulgaria
EIN18 min read

EIN Tips for OPT workers from Bulgaria

OPT workers in Bulgaria need an EIN for U.S. business operations. Learn the specific requirements, application process, and common pitfalls for obtaining your EIN.

Reviewed by , ITIN Specialist at itin.net.

OPT Workers in Bulgaria Face Unique EIN Challenges

Obtaining an Employer Identification Number (EIN) presents distinct hurdles for Optional Practical Training (OPT) workers residing in Bulgaria. Unlike U.S. residents who can often apply online, non-residents, particularly those outside the U.S., face a longer processing timeline and specific documentation requirements. The primary friction point for this audience is the inability to use the IRS online portal, which is restricted to individuals with a U.S. Social Security Number (SSN). Since many OPT workers may not yet have an SSN or may be outside the U.S. during their OPT period, they must navigate the non-resident application process. This typically involves faxing or mailing Form SS-4 to the IRS, a method that significantly extends the time to receive the EIN. Furthermore, understanding the nuances of U.S. business formation and tax obligations while based in Bulgaria requires careful attention to detail to avoid common errors that can delay or jeopardize the application.

When You Need an EIN as an OPT Worker in Bulgaria

An EIN is a federal tax identification number required for U.S. businesses. For OPT workers in Bulgaria operating a U.S. business, an EIN becomes necessary in several key scenarios. Most commonly, it is required if you are forming a U.S. business entity, such as a U.S. LLC or C-Corp, and need to open a U.S. bank account. Many U.S. banks require an EIN to open a business account, even for non-resident owners. Another trigger is the need to hire employees within the U.S., which necessitates an EIN for payroll tax purposes. Even if your business is solely online and operated from Bulgaria, certain platforms or payment processors might require an EIN for verification or tax reporting. For instance, if you are establishing a U.S. LLC, an EIN is often a prerequisite for setting up the business structure and fulfilling reporting obligations, such as filing Form 5472 for transactions with a foreign-owned U.S. disregarded entity. Without an EIN, you may be unable to legally operate your U.S. business or access essential financial services.

Required Documents for Your EIN Application

To apply for an EIN as a non-resident OPT worker in Bulgaria, you will need specific documentation to satisfy the IRS requirements. The core form is the IRS Form SS-4, Application for Employer Identification Number. This form requires detailed information about your U.S. business, including its legal name, address, and the type of business entity. Critically, for the responsible party who has no SSN, line 7b of Form SS-4 must be completed by writing 'Foreign' instead of an SSN. You must also include a valid passport for the responsible party applying for the EIN. If your U.S. business is a newly formed entity, you will need to provide formation documents, such as Articles of Incorporation or Organization, depending on your entity type (e.g., for a U.S. LLC). A U.S. business address is also a common requirement; if you do not have a physical U.S. office, you may need to use a mail forwarding service or the address of your registered agent. Ensure all documents are accurate and consistent, as discrepancies can lead to application delays.

The Non-Resident EIN Application Process and Timeline

Since OPT workers in Bulgaria typically do not have an SSN, the application process for an EIN differs significantly from that of U.S. residents. You cannot apply online. Instead, you must complete and submit IRS Form SS-4 via fax or mail. After completing the form, you will fax it to the IRS at 855-641-0829 (for EINs) or mail it to the appropriate IRS address for non-residents. The typical processing timeline for non-residents applying via fax or mail is approximately 3 to 5 weeks. This is considerably longer than the 1–2 business days for U.S. residents applying online. It is crucial to ensure the form is filled out completely and accurately to avoid delays. The IRS will issue your EIN on a CP-575 notice, which will be mailed to the U.S. business address listed on your application. You may also receive a CP-48 notice if additional information is required. Patience is essential during this period.

Common Application Mistakes for OPT Workers in Bulgaria

OPT workers in Bulgaria often encounter specific pitfalls when applying for an EIN. A frequent error is attempting to apply online despite not having an SSN; the IRS system will reject these applications. Another common mistake is incorrectly completing line 7b of Form SS-4, where individuals without an SSN or ITIN must write 'Foreign.' Entering an incorrect entity type or business structure can also cause issues. For those forming a U.S. LLC, it's vital to understand that a disregarded entity with no U.S. tax filing obligations still needs an EIN if it has employees or is owned by a foreign person, which then triggers Form 5472 filing requirements. Ensure your U.S. business address is valid and can receive mail; a non-deliverable address can lead to rejection. Mismatched legal names between the responsible party's passport and business formation documents are also a frequent cause for denial.

How a Certified Acceptance Agent (CAA) Streamlines the Process

Applying for an EIN as a non-resident can be complex and time-consuming. For OPT workers in Bulgaria, utilizing a Certified Acceptance Agent (CAA) like itin.net can significantly expedite and simplify the process. A CAA is an individual or entity appointed by the IRS to assist non-residents in obtaining an EIN. When you apply through a CAA, they act as an intermediary, verifying your identity and business information before submitting the Form SS-4 to the IRS on your behalf. This can shorten the processing time, especially when compared to the standard fax or mail method for non-residents. The CAA pathway often allows for faster communication with the IRS if any issues arise with the application. By ensuring accuracy and completeness upfront, CAAs help mitigate the risk of application errors that could lead to delays. This service is particularly valuable for those unfamiliar with U.S. tax forms and procedures.

Next Steps After Obtaining Your EIN

Once you have successfully obtained your EIN, you can proceed with establishing your U.S. business operations. The most immediate next step for many is opening a U.S. bank account. With your EIN and business formation documents, you can approach U.S. banks or financial institutions like Mercury, Relay, or Brex to open a business checking or savings account, which is essential for managing your business finances separately from personal funds. If your business is a U.S. LLC owned by a foreign person, you will likely need to file Form 5472 annually to report transactions between the LLC and its owner, even if no tax is due. Familiarize yourself with other U.S. federal, state, and local tax obligations relevant to your business activities. You can review itin.net's EIN application service pricing and details or contact us directly if you require assistance navigating this process.

Practical tips

  • Write 'Foreign' on line 7b of Form SS-4 if the responsible party does not have an SSN or ITIN.
  • Use a mail forwarding service or your registered agent's address if you lack a physical U.S. business address.
  • Ensure the legal name on Form SS-4 exactly matches your passport and business formation documents.
  • If you are forming a U.S. LLC owned by a foreign person, be aware of the annual Form 5472 filing requirement.
  • Factor in the 3–5 week processing time for non-resident EIN applications submitted via fax or mail.

Frequently asked questions

Can I apply for an EIN online from Bulgaria?

No, OPT workers in Bulgaria cannot apply for an EIN online because the IRS online application portal requires a U.S. Social Security Number (SSN), which most OPT workers do not possess. You must use the fax or mail application method for Form SS-4.

How long does it take to get an EIN from Bulgaria?

For non-residents applying from Bulgaria, the typical processing time for an EIN via fax or mail is 3 to 5 weeks. This timeframe can be reduced by using a Certified Acceptance Agent (CAA).

What U.S. business address do I need for an EIN application?

You need a valid U.S. business address for your EIN application. If you don't have a physical office, you can use the address of your registered agent or a mail forwarding service. This address is where the IRS will send your EIN confirmation (CP-575 notice).

Do I need an ITIN to get an EIN?

No, an ITIN (Individual Taxpayer Identification Number) is not required to obtain an EIN. If you do not have an SSN or ITIN, you must write 'Foreign' in the designated field on Form SS-4.

What is the difference between a U.S. resident and a non-resident EIN application?

U.S. residents with an SSN can apply online and typically receive their EIN within 1-2 business days. Non-residents, like OPT workers in Bulgaria without an SSN, must apply via fax or mail, which takes 3-5 weeks. Using a Certified Acceptance Agent can expedite the non-resident process.

Can I open a U.S. bank account with an EIN obtained from Bulgaria?

Yes, once you have your EIN, you can use it to open a U.S. bank account. Many U.S. banks and financial services like Mercury, Relay, or Brex require an EIN for business account openings, even for non-resident business owners.

Ready to Apply for Your ITIN?

Our IRS-Certified Acceptance Agents make the process simple and remote — from anywhere in the world.

  • IRS Certified
  • 5–10 Business Days
  • Money-Back Guarantee